The microcrystalline state of slowly solidified decaprismatic Al-Co-Cu(-Si) needles

摘要

We show that samples of the decagonal Al-Co-Cu(-Si) phase produced by different slow solidification methods are in the microcrystalline and not in the quasicryjstalline state. Parameters for the underlying unit cell are a =b*=* 51-3 A, c = 4-lA and y= 108°. Experiments on differently produced samples show the same microcrystalline state and that the (5,7) approximant seems to be highly favoured, compared with the set of possible high-order approximant states.
